@classmethod
def from_stream(klass, io_obj: io.IOBase):
"""Load image from readable IO stream

Convert to BytesIO to enable seeking, if input stream is not seekable

Parameters
----------
io_obj : IOBase object
Readable stream
"""
if not io_obj.seekable():
io_obj = io.BytesIO(io_obj.read())
return klass.from_file_map(klass._filemap_from_iobase(io_obj))

def to_stream(self, io_obj: io.IOBase, **kwargs):
"""Save image to writable IO stream

Parameters
----------
io_obj : IOBase object
Writable stream
\*\*kwargs : keyword arguments
Keyword arguments that may be passed to ``img.to_file_map()``
"""
self.to_file_map(self._filemap_from_iobase(io_obj), **kwargs)

@classmethod
def from_url(klass, url, timeout=5):
"""Retrieve and load an image from a URL

Class method

Parameters
----------
url : str or urllib.request.Request object
URL of file to retrieve
timeout : float, optional
Time (in seconds) to wait for a response
"""
response = request.urlopen(url, timeout=timeout)
return klass.from_stream(response)
